Heads up on Fablewick, our test-data factory lib. CI runs are now generating ~3x more fixtures than last quarter, and the shared seed cache on the Dunmore runners is nearly full. Before it tips over, we're capping per-suite fixture counts and trimming cache TTLs — cheap wins, no code changes needed in suites. If nightly builds start failing on cache misses, bump the pool, not the TTL. Current caps are set as follows.

tuning constants:
QUOTAS = {
    "druwyn": 5,
    "holix": 5,
    "zorath": 5,
    "holwyn": 10,
}

Subject: Insurance Renewal — For Board Review

Executive team,

Our policy with Graymont Assurance renews at month-end. Terms were reviewed by Helena Voss and broadly match last year, with a 3% premium increase tied to the new Eastvale warehouse. Cyber cover has been added at modest cost. Finance recommends proceeding. Please note the confidential business plan item included below.

Regards,
T. Arkwright, CFO

internal memo for bahap-yagug: Headcount on the Ulaix team goes from 3 to 100 by the end of January. Gross margin on Ulaix came in at 10 percent against a plan of 15 percent.

### Cron drift — Larkspur scheduler

Quick recap for release: the nightly jobs on Larkspur have been sliding later each week, about 40 seconds per run. Looks like the scheduler host's clock sync is flaky, not the jobs themselves. Hold the release until we confirm. To reproduce the drift locally, start the scheduler with the following configuration.

settings of kageg-yawig:
[casix]
host = casix.tolvaqlabs.corp
user = casix_svc
database = casix_prod